See why so many travelers make Ararat Hotel their hotel of choice when visiting Bethlehem. Providing an ideal mix of value, comfort and convenience, it offers a family-friendly setting with an array of amenities designed for travelers like you.

Nearby landmarks such as Carmel of the Child Jesus (0.9 mi) and Solomon's Pools (2.8 mi) make Ararat Hotel a great place to stay when visiting Bethlehem.

Rooms at Ararat Hotel offer a minibar and air conditioning providing exceptional comfort and convenience, and guests can go online with free wifi.

A 24 hour front desk, currency exchange, and baggage storage are some of the conveniences offered at this hotel. A pool and free breakfast will also help to make your stay even more special. If you are driving to Ararat Hotel, free parking is available.

While in Bethlehem, you may want to check out some of the restaurants that are a short walk away from Ararat Hotel, including Afteem (0.5 mi), Star & Bucks Bethlehem (0.5 mi), and Fawda Cafe and Restaurant (0.6 mi).

Looking to explore? Then look no further than Church of the Nativity (0.4 mi), The Church of St. Catherine (0.4 mi), and Milk Grotto (0.3 mi), which are some popular Bethlehem attractions – all conveniently located within walking distance of the hotel.

I booked the Hotel with a well known webpage and received a confirmation.on check in I was told the Hotel is overbooked. I persisted on the confirmation and after 1 hour of work, the reception could manage to get me my room.
The room itself has a standard size but was far not standard to a 4 star Hotel. The shower was broken, water pressure is set to minimum and it takes a while until you cleaned your head from the shampoo. Shampoo and shower gel (lady smell like) is supaplied from a dispenser on the wall. The towels are cheapest quality and there are no hangers for them in the bathroom. The bed and Mattress is ok. The room has a fridge,but it is empty. A water cooker is there but no coffee or tea and no cup! Two bottle of water are supplied, but only on the first day. The walls are very thin and shaking when the door in other rooms are closing. A lot of noise from the corridor every time people walk outside. Windows also very thinn and you can hear also the noise from the street and the dogs around.
I personally, if I must stay again in this hotel (not if I have any other possibility) would never book the room including breakfast. Only the cheapest food is used, orange juice and jam are chemical. Cold milk is stretched with water and any kind of better coffee as well as prepared eggs cost extra and at very high price. The breakfast room is prepared for big tourist groups and is also used for weddings and dinner at evening. The advertised Gym is ok but not very big any on peak times crowded. The swimmimgpool is ok but even as hotel guest u$ 10.-- extra Charge. All in all to expensive for what you get. During my weekend tourist groups fron Nigeria, Poland and Romania been booked in there.

If you ask me and my experience - 2 Stars European level maximal.
